Abstract
Pressure equalizing means for well tools having a tubular housing and an operator tube movable longitudinally therewithin, there being provided a valved bypass passage in the housing and a shoulder on the operator tube for engaging and opening the valve of the valved bypass passage upon longitudinal movement of the operator tube in the housing, the equalizing mechanism further including a pair of seal rings sealing between the housing and the operator tube above and below the valved bypass passage in the housing and a lateral passage in the wall of the operator tube normally above the pair of seals but movable under no-flow conditions with the operator tube to a position between the pair of seals prior to the operator tube shoulder contacting the valve of the bypass passage, thus avoiding damage to or flow cutting of the seals which normally form a secondary seal to provide bubble-tight integrity even if the valve in the bypass passage does not seal bubble tight.
